5 CSR 25-400.086 Fire Safety
Violation
| Provider Comments |
Violation The means of egress in the main play area was obstructed in that cozy coups were placed in front of the exit.. Licensing Rule Reference 5 CSR 25-400.086 Fire Safety 1 (M) states: Means of egress is a continuous and unobstructed way of travel from any point in a building or structure to a public way. A means of egress consists of three (3) distinct parts: the exit access, the exit, and the exit discharge. Correction Required Means of egress must be unobstructed.

5 CSR 25-400.095 Furniture, Equipment and Materials
Violation
| Provider Comments |
Violation Infant sleeping requirements were not met as evidenced by soft materials or objects were placed under a sleeping infant in that A blanket was observed in the crib of 10 month old child.. Licensing Rule Reference 5 CSR 25-400.095 Furniture, Equipment and Materials 1 (B) 2 D states: Soft materials or objects such as pillows, quilts, comforters, or sheepskins, even if covered by a sheet, shall not be placed under a sleeping infant. If a mattress cover to protect against wetness is used, it shall be tight fitting and thin. Correction Required Infant sleeping requirements shall be met.

5 CSR 25-400.105 The Child Care Provider and Other Child Care Personnel
Violation
| Provider Comments |
Violation The requirements for obtaining 12 clock hours each calendar year were not met. For the calendar year of 2021, the staff listed need the following information: Tanya Johnson. Licensing Rule Reference 5 CSR 25-400.105 The Child Care Provider and Other Child Care Personnel (4) (A) states: The provider shall obtain at least twelve (12) clock hours of child care-related training during each calendar year. Any assistant who works or volunteers more than five (5) hours per week shall meet the same training requirements. Clock hour training shall be approved by the department. Correction Required Required training hours shall be documented for each caregiver.
